Job Summary
Instructional PreK-K Educational Coach role with Teaching Matters in New York. Per diem and full-time opportunities available within a national nonprofit focused on expanding an early childhood program. Responsibilities include implementing an interactive read-aloud and small-group program, developing customized instructional coaching plans for teachers and leaders, coaching teachers within coaching cycles to build key competencies, differentiating support, facilitating teacher teams to analyze data and address inequitable practices, guiding leaders in changing systems and communications to prioritize student success, and building proficiency in culturally responsive pedagogy and racial literacy. Requires strong early childhood expertise, effective coaching and presentation skills, urban-education experience, and adept use of technology tools (Zoom, Google Suite) to support collaboration and professional development. Per diem rates and full-time salary ranges are provided, with a commitment to equity and inclusive employment.
Required Qualifications
- Minimum of 4 years experience in early childhood education as a PreK Classroom teacher
- Strong content knowledge in early childhood development with a lens to culturally responsive curriculum and pedagogy.
- Demonstrated effectiveness in achieving ambitious, measurable student results.
- Experience facilitating teacher teams / groups to achieve student outcomes.
- Dynamic presenter, comfortable engaging large groups of educators in professional workshops and work-sessions.
- Experience teaching and/or coaching teachers in culturally responsive practices and curriculum development.
- Passion for advocating for students and communities traditionally marginalized and under-resourced.
- Experience in urban schools.
- Exemplar skills in technology and facile in utilizing zoom, google suite, and other online collaboration tools.
- Strong critical thinking and problem-solving skills, well organized, excellent writing and communication skills.
- Superior interpersonal skills to motivate and lead others at all levels within a school.
